TPS82671/x675600mA Fully Integrated, Low Noise Step-Down Converter in MicroSIP™ Features Benefits • Regulated Switching Frequency: 5.5MHz • All required external components are integrated • Spread Spectrum, PWM Frequency Dithering, High PSRR and low ripple Power Save Mode • Automatic Power Safe Mode transition or forced PWM Mode operation • Input voltage: 2.3V to 4.8V • Allows < 7mm2 total solution size, thus provides 90mA/mm2 • One-Stop-Shop, reduced HW design workload and no more questionable designs • Supports noise sensitive applications through improved RF spurious performance and radiated noise reduction • Allows to choose between high efficiency over entire load range (PSM) or regulated fixed frequency • Supports Li-Ion batteries with extended voltage range Applications • Mid to High end Cell Phones, Smart-Phones • Portable Audio/Video • Digital TV, WLAN, GPS and Bluetooth™and portable medical device TPS82671EVM-646 TPS82675EVM-646
